Output 7d791124c72e473f08240f48fa4d3ea48e31e39730366b91dc55289d373a3ce2:1

value
18140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ebe98fa5ccb1680ef685a19b6b0ec230a6f5f1 OP_EQUAL
address
39huKi9jqwKvgfzdFBWpscBgA1Cf7ThJQt
transaction
7d791124c72e473f08240f48fa4d3ea48e31e39730366b91dc55289d373a3ce2
spent
true